Ghaziabad, considered as Gateway to Uttar Pradesh, is emerged as major industrial hub. Ghaziabad has grown well into a modern town and is known for its ISKCON temple.
Ghaziabad is located in National Capital region in state of India. Ghaziabad has everything of a modern town from skyscrapers to bustling markets and traffic congestion also. Ghaziabad is industrial hub as well as a plus, polished and sophisticated town. City is hub of many industries including electric locomotive and EMU trains, bicycles, tapestry, pottery, paint and varnish, metal chains etc. Ghaziabad is shoppers paradise. It houses large number of malls offers global commercial brands. Shopping in these malls are must if you are in Ghaziabad. Ghaziabad has embraced technology and modernity but still a part of Ghaziabad has old world charm with its narrow streets and road side stalls which still carry warmth in it. Main attractions of the town are ISKCON temple and Laxmi Narayan temple. Nearby towns Dadri and Dasani also attracts tourists. Dadri is popular among offbeat travelers and nature lovers. Mohan nagar is another famous small town near Ghaziabad. It is famous for Institute of Science and technology, Mohan nagar temple and World Square mall.

1. Bikaner - Located around 100 kilometers from Suratgarh, Bikaner is known for its majestic palaces, rich cultural heritage, and delicious local cuisine. The Junagarh Fort, Lalgarh Palace, and Karni Mata Temple are popular attractions here.
2. Jaipur - The capital city of Rajasthan, Jaipur is around 360 kilometers from Suratgarh. Known as the Pink City, it is famous for its stunning palaces, vibrant markets, and royal heritage. Amber Fort, City Palace, Hawa Mahal, and Jantar Mantar are some must-visit attractions in Jaipur.
3. Agra - Agra, located approximately 590 kilometers from Suratgarh, is home to the iconic Taj Mahal, one of the Seven Wonders of the World. Apart from the Taj Mahal, Agra Fort, Fatehpur Sikri, and Itmad-ud-Daulah's Tomb are other notable attractions in the city.
4. Mathura - Mathura, situated around 660 kilometers from Suratgarh, is a revered pilgrimage site for Hindus, as it is believed to be the birthplace of Lord Krishna. The Krishna Janmabhoomi Temple, Dwarkadhish Temple, and Govardhan Hill are significant attractions here.
5. Noida - Noida is a modern city located near Ghaziabad, famous for its shopping malls, amusement parks, and entertainment centers. Worlds of Wonder, DLF Mall of India, and The Great India Place are popular places to visit in Noida.
